hpd_banner_nyreblog_com_.jpgLandmarks Preservation Commission (LPC) Warehouse Request for Proposals

The New York City Department of Housing Preservation and Development (HPD) is inviting developers to submit proposals for a new construction project in Williamsburg, Brooklyn. This RFP is in accordance with the Mayor's New Housing Marketplace Plan, which responds to the housing needs of New York's communities by committing to the new construction or rehabilitation of 165,000 housing units by 2014. The proposed Project serves the Plan's critical goals of creating needed housing opportunities, maximizing affordability, and in turn, enhancing the City's community revitalization efforts.
